Aegon actually only started on Dragonstone because the Targs owned Dragonstone long before he was born. His actual conquest started near the place where today King's Landing is, where he landed with 1.6k soldiers, his two sisters and 3 dragons. If you factor in the fact that Dany's army has large contingents of troops that specialize on land warfare (Unsullied, Dothraki) and might even be unfit for amphibious warfare (Dothraki in particular) it makes no sense to land on Dragonstone, which offers no advantages except for ~it's my hoooommmmmeeee~
